Section 34-26-570. Annual and other meetings of credit union membership.

Universal Citation: SC Code § 34-26-570 (2017)

(1) The annual meeting and any special meetings of the members of the credit union shall be held in accordance with the bylaws.

(2) At all such meetings all natural members shall have one vote, irrespective of the member's share holdings. No member may vote by proxy, but a member may vote by absentee ballot, mail, or other method if the bylaws of the credit union so provide. Accounts held by organizations must be considered nonvoting members.

(3) The board of directors may establish a minimum age, not greater than eighteen years of age, as a qualification of eligibility to vote at meetings of the members or to hold office, or both.

HISTORY: 1996 Act No. 371, Section 1, eff May 29, 1996.
